How does a scientist test their hypothesis?

Respuesta :

bruhbruhbruh694202
bruhbruhbruh694202 bruhbruhbruh694202
  • 23-09-2020

Answer:

Conducting experiments and using the scientific method.

Explanation:

Scientists (and other people) test hypotheses by conducting experiments. The purpose of an experiment is to determine whether observations of the real world agree with or conflict with the predictions derived from a hypothesis. If they agree, confidence in the hypothesis increases; otherwise, it decreases.
